Malaria
A disease caused by a plasmodium parasite, transmitted by the bite of infected mosquitoes, characterized by fever, chills, and anemia.
Apicomplexans
A group of protozoan parasites, known for their role in diseases such as malaria.
Parasitic
Describes organisms that live on or in a host organism and get their food at the expense of their host, often causing harm.
Amoebozoa
Members of the unikont clade characterized by lobose pseudopodia at some time in the life cycle; include amoebas, plasmodial slime molds, and cellular slime molds. Compare with opisthokonts.
